Connects to the AC/DC adapter.
Connects to a PC using a MINI DP cable.
Connects to an external device using the HDMI cable supplied by Samsung (which is a High Speed
HDMI certified cable).
Connects to a source device using a USB Type-C cable. When connecting a USB
Type-C source device, make sure to use the USB Type-C 3.1 Gen2 10G cable so that
the screen is displayed properly.
"
Lower version cables do not support the video input function (Displayport ALT).
The USB Type-C port can be connected to a notebook or mobile device for
charging.
"
A maximum of 65 W charging power is supported. The charging speed may vary,
depending on the connected device.
Use a camera from the PC connected to the USB Type-C port.
Connects to a USB device, such as a keyboard or mouse.
"
A maximum of 15 W charging power is supported. The charging speed may vary, depending
on the connected device.
